Freigeben über


ChangeParentResourcePool-Methode der CIM_ResourcePoolConfigurationService-Klasse

Starten Sie einen Auftrag, um einen übergeordneten Pool mit den angegebenen Zuordnungseinstellungen zu ändern.

Syntax

uint32 ChangeParentResourcePool(
  [in]  CIM_ResourcePool REF ChildPool,
  [in]  CIM_ResourcePool REF ParentPool[],
  [in]  string               Settings[],
  [out] CIM_ConcreteJob  REF Job
);

Parameter

ChildPool [in]

Ein CIM_ResourcePool , der auf den untergeordneten Pool verweist.

ParentPool [in]

Ein CIM_ResourcePool Array, das auf die übergeordneten Pools verweist.

Einstellungen [in]

Optionale Zeichenfolge, die eine Darstellung einer CIM_SettingData instance enthält, die zum Angeben der Einstellungen für den übergeordneten Pool verwendet wird.

Auftrag [out]

Ein CIM_ConcreteJob , der auf den Auftrag verweist (kann NULL sein, wenn der Auftrag abgeschlossen ist).

Rückgabewert

Gibt bei Erfolg eine 0 zurück; Gibt andernfalls einen Fehler zurück.

Auftrag ohne Fehler abgeschlossen (0)

Nicht unterstützt (1)

Unbekannt (2)

Timeout (3)

Fehler (4)

Ungültiger Parameter (5)

In Verwendung (6)

Falscher ResourceType für den Pool (7)

Unzureichende Ressourcen (8)

DMTF Reserviert (..)

Methodenparameter überprüft – Auftrag gestartet (4096)

Größe nicht unterstützt (4097)

Reservierte Methode (4098..32767)

Herstellerspezifisch (32768..65535)

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client)
Windows 8.1
Unterstützte Mindestversion (Server)
Windows Server 2012 R2
Namespace
Root\virtualization\v2
MOF
WindowsVirtualization.V2.mof
DLL
Vmms.exe

Siehe auch

CIM_ResourcePoolConfigurationService